Transaction 25b91aa63b8df601022ab2442a30b4057a68188ef5883af2e798ead9ccd0ed79

1 Input
2 Outputs
  • 25b91aa63b8df601022ab2442a30b4057a68188ef5883af2e798ead9ccd0ed79:0
  • value  3461776
    address  17bK1DZSsHiTej7oq61D9BT3Vg4jSqWyjy
  • 25b91aa63b8df601022ab2442a30b4057a68188ef5883af2e798ead9ccd0ed79:1
  • value  138000963
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o